The United States medical UV disinfection equipment market by application is segmented into several key sectors:
Hospitals constitute the largest segment in the market, driven by the need for efficient disinfection solutions to reduce hospital-acquired infections (HAIs). UV disinfection systems are increasingly adopted in operating rooms, patient rooms, and other critical areas to enhance patient safety and maintain hygiene standards.
Clinics represent another significant segment, leveraging UV disinfection technology to sanitize examination rooms, waiting areas, and equipment surfaces. The rising outpatient care services and the emphasis on infection control contribute to the adoption of UV disinfection equipment in clinics across the US.
Ambulatory Surgical Centers (ASCs) are adopting UV disinfection equipment to ensure the sterility of surgical environments and equipment between procedures. This segment benefits from the compact and efficient UV systems that facilitate quick turnaround times and compliance with stringent sterilization protocols.
Pharmaceutical companies utilize UV disinfection equipment primarily in manufacturing facilities and laboratories to maintain aseptic conditions and prevent contamination during production processes. This segment demands reliable disinfection solutions to meet regulatory requirements and ensure product safety.
The ‘Others’ category includes various healthcare facilities such as nursing homes, rehabilitation centers, and diagnostic laboratories that deploy UV disinfection systems to supplement standard cleaning protocols and safeguard vulnerable patient populations.
